Hello Geoffrey,

i've seen your post today. I downloaded all zip files, but i even didn't manage to install Supersonic plugin in Kodi: everytime i try to install it from above zip file, i get Kodi message about installation failed due to invalid structure. I tried unzipping the file and rezipping again; i tried unzipping and copying the directory into Kodi addons directory... Nothing works.

What do you suggest?

Ok, solved that. It seems the problem is in the directory structure inside the zip file, as inside the file there is a first plugin.audio.supersonic directory and a second plugin.audio.supersonic directory inside the first. By eliminating one of the two the error disappears.

Tested Kodi local file reproduction in local hqplayer so far. It works (even for mp3 files), but with some problems if i stop playing and try to start again/with another file.
